ECU-MAN
11-04-2016, 07:54 AM
The connector in your hand is the IAT sensor connector.

Not sure what you have connected to the IAT at the moment, however if it is the purge solenoid connector you have damaged the IAT and possibly the ECU.

Best follow the IAT test procedure to resolve the problem.
